LSE Summer Schools Program for 2008

London School of Economic announces the Summer Schools programs for 2008.

Dates for Summer School 2008:
Session 1: 7 July - 25 July
Session 2: 28 July - 15 August

Registration and Induction:
Session 1: 6 July (12pm - 5pm)
Session 2: 27 July (2pm - 5pm)

Courses:
-Accounting and Finance;
-Economics;
-English Language;
-International Relations, Government and Society;
-Law;
-Management;
-Advanced Corporate Finance;
-Behaviour in Organisations and Anthropology.

Important:
The new programme for 2008 is now available online and we are accepting applications.

The tuition fees for the 2008 programme are: Reduced Student Fees: £1, 125 for one session or £1,900 for two sessions. This rate applies to all full time students who are currently enrolled at a University or College anywhere in the world. Standard Rate Fees: £1,450 for one session or £2,500 for two sessions. For those returning to the Summer School or LSE alumni, a 10% discount is offered.

Please note: The application deadline is 31st May. Any applications received after this date will incur a late application charge of £60 bringing the total application fee to £110. The best way to apply now is using the online application facility.
